Most of us know the irritation of losing out on a good night’s sleep but did you know that chronic sleep interruption can seriously affect your health? In order to function properly, we all need to sleep well and for sufficient hours. A lack of sleep or sleep interruption can lead to fatigue, sickness, and depression.
Snoring can be a major cause of chronic sleep interruption and can result in headaches, fatigue, irritability, depression, weight gain, and a decreased libido. It can also contribute to major sleep disorders such as sleep deprivation (a serious lack of sleep) and sleep-apnea, both of which can have life-threatening side-effects.
SLEEP-APNEA – A SNORE YOU CAN’T IGNORE
Have you or a loved one ever experienced the following while sleeping
- Very loud and heavy snoring
- Waking up gasping, snorting, choking or with a headache
- Long pauses in breathing
- Excessive daytime drowsiness
If you suspect that you have sleep apnea, you should consult a doctor immediately to determine the severity of your condition. Mild to moderate sleep-apnea can be treated in a similar way to the treatments used to help stop snoring such as weight loss, changing your sleeping position, or using an anti-snoring device.
